As a regular user of the Xen tarballs, two things keep annoying me:

1) All the files are write-protected. Would be nice if they were 
writable, as is the case with most other source tgz's you find on the net.

2) The file freebsd-5.3-xen-sparse/i386-xen/compile/.cvsignore seems to 
have nothing to do here.

I know this is nitpicking to the extreme, but I would be grateful if 
someone with the right level of access would be kind enough to fix these 
minor issues at some point.
